What We Do
Founded in 2004, Virtuos is one of the largest independent video game development companies. We are headquartered in Singapore with offices in Asia, Europe, and North America. Specializing in full-cycle game development and art production, we have delivered high-quality content for more than 1,500 console, PC, and mobile games.
